将橡胶轴承支撑的转轴/轴承系统简化为非线性弹性支撑的转轴/轴承系统。基于非线性动力学及分叉理论进行分析、研究,确定周期无碰摩响应边界、碰摩运动边界、稳定性边界。结果表明,同频全周碰摩、跳跃现象及碰摩响应在周期、非周期运动间过渡;通过对阻尼比、偏心率等系统参数对系统动态响应特性影响分析获得参数平面内不同碰摩响应区域边界。因而可较好理解系统参数与不同系统响应特性间关系。

The model of a general bearing/shaft rubbing system with nonlinear elastic support of stator was established and analyzed by using the modern nonlinear dynamics and bifurcation theories.The boundaries for the existence of no-rub responses were determined analytically,the synchronous full annular rub solution was derived and the stability was analyzed to determine the region of synchronous full annular rub responses.The results provide an opportunity for better understanding the dynamical characteristics of the system,such as the synchronous full annular rub motion,the jump phenomena as well as the transition between full annular periodic rub motion and unstable rub motions.A systematic study on the influence of system parameters,such as damping and eccentricity on the dynamics characteristics was carried out.An overall picture of the response characteristics of the model was then obtained by drawing existence boundaries in parameter space.The presented results provide good understanding on the relationship between different rubbing responses and system parameters.
